[알고리즘 문제풀이] SHA-256

황인권·2023년 3월 7일
0

알고리즘 문제풀이

목록 보기
6/81

문제 제목 : SHA-256

문제 난이도 : 하

문제 유형 : 해시, 구현

https://www.acmicpc.net/problem/10930
시간 제한 : 1초
메모리 제한 : 256MB

문제풀이 아이디어

  1. hashlib의 sha256 함수를 이용 -> SHA 256 해시를 구할 수 있다.
  2. hashlib.sha256(문자열 바이트 객체).hexdigest() : 해시 결과 문자열

< 소스코드 >

import hashlib

input_data = input()
encoded_data = input_data.encode()
result = hashlib.sha256(encoded_data).hexdigest()
print(result)
profile
inkwon Hwang

0개의 댓글